### What changes were proposed in this pull request? Support Netty level logging at the network layer for Celeborn. To configure Netty level logging a LogHandler must be added to the channel pipeline. `NettyLogger` is introduced as a new class which is able to construct a log handler depending on the log level: - In case of `<Logger name="org.apache.celeborn.common.network.util.NettyLogger" level="DEBUG" additivity="false">`: a custom log handler is created which does not dump the message contents. This way the log is a bit more compact. Moreover when network level encryption is switched on this level might be sufficient. - In case of `<Logger name="org.apache.celeborn.common.network.util.NettyLogger" level="TRACE" additivity="false">`: Netty's own log handler is used which dumps the message contents. - Otherwise (when the logger is not `TRACE` or `DEBUG`) the pipeline does not contain a log handler (there is no runtime penalty for the default setting but a long running service must be restarted along with the new log level to have an effect). Backport: - [[SPARK-36719][CORE] Supporting Netty Logging at the network layer](apache/spark#33962) - [[SPARK-45377][CORE] Handle InputStream in NettyLogger](apache/spark#43165) ### Why are the changes needed? This level of logging proved to be sufficient during debugging some external shuffle related problem. Compared with the tcpdump this log lines can be more easily correlated with the Celeborn internal calls. Moreover the log layout can be configured to contain the thread names that way for a timeout a busy thread could be identified. ### Does this PR introduce _any_ user-facing change? What changes were proposed in this pull request?
Supporting Netty level logging at the network layer.
To configure Netty level logging a
LogHandlermust be added to the channel pipeline.In this PR I have introduced a new class
NettyLoggerwhich is able to construct a log handler depending on the log level:log4j.logger.org.apache.spark.network.util.NettyLogger=DEBUG: a custom log handler is created which does not dump the message contents. This way the log is a bit more compact. Moreover when network level encryption is switched on this level might be sufficient.log4j.logger.org.apache.spark.network.util.NettyLogger=TRACE: Netty's own log handler is used which dumps the message contents.Why are the changes needed?
This level of logging proved to be sufficient during debugging some external shuffle related problem.
Compared with the tcpdump this log lines can be more easily correlated with the Spark internal calls.
Moreover the log layout can be configured to contain the thread names that way for a timeout a busy thread could be identified.
